PULASKI COUNTY (8-31) –     Multiple lanes on Riverfront Drive will be closed through early November, requiring a temporary traffic shift, according to Arkansas Department of Transportation (ARDOT) officials.

Weather permitting, crews will close the westbound lanes of Riverfront Drive between Pine and Olive Streets in North Little Rock, below the Interstate 30 bridge. A single-lane of westbound traffic will shift into the eastbound lanes, temporarily transitioning Riverfront Drive into a two-way traffic pattern. Traffic will be head-to-head beginning Tuesday, September 7 through early November. These operations are part of a maintenance of traffic plan to construct the new I-30 eastbound river bridge structure.

What is the Connecting Arkansas Program?

Through a voter-approved constitutional amendment, the people of Arkansas passed a 10-year, half-cent sales tax to improve highway and infrastructure projects.

Which Projects Are Being Funded By This program?

Thirty-one projects in 19 corridors across Arkansas are included in the CAP, which improves transportation connections to the four corners of Arkansas.
